ECOS is a managed mineral technology system for the development and local production of construction materials. It combines a technology core, qualification of local raw materials, functional adaptation, development of application configurations, engineering documentation and performance verification.
ECOS is not a single formulation and not a universal ready-made product. It is an engineering system that makes it possible to adapt the technology to specific raw materials, equipment, a production site and an area of use.
4Bricks s.r.o. develops, protects, commercially manages and implements ECOS within a controlled technological and contractual architecture.

Under the licensing model, the partner receives an agreed right to use ECOS industrially for a defined territory, production site and application configuration.
Licensing does not transfer ownership of ECOS, intellectual property or confidential engineering know-how.
For selected projects, 4Bricks may use a deeper technology partnership model instead of a classic licence.
Equity participation is neither mandatory nor automatic and is determined individually for each project.
The commercial structure of ECOS is defined individually. It depends on the application configuration, territory, production site, local raw materials, validation stage, scope of engineering support and the selected cooperation model.
The ECOS technology core, engineering methods, controlled parameters, documentation and know-how form a managed system of intellectual property and technological knowledge of 4Bricks.
4Bricks retains control over the ECOS technology core, confidential engineering know-how and the rights associated with commercial use and licensing of the technology.
Granting a partner rights to use ECOS does not transfer ownership of the technology.
Specific usage rights are defined by contract and may be limited by territory, production site, application configuration, area of use, term and other agreed parameters.
This principle applies both to the licensing model and to technology partnership.
Key process parameters, engineering models, adaptation methods and other critical ECOS elements may constitute confidential know-how and are provided only to the extent required for the agreed project.
Access to such information is governed by NDA and the relevant contractual documents.
